Rutger Hauer Highlights

  • 2005: Starred in "Sin City" the adaptation of comic book icon Frank Miller's uber-noir series of grapic novels; co-directed by Miller and Robert Rodriguez
  • 2005: Starred as Earle, a businessman who has designs on Wayne Enterprises, in "Batman Begins," which stares Christian Bale as Batman
  • 2002: Played a mysterious assassin in director George Clooney's "Confessions of a Dangerous Mind"
  • 1998: Appeared in the acclaimed NBC miniseries "Merlin"
  • 1998: Starred in the thriller "Bone Daddy"
  • 1994: Starred in the HBO movie "Fatherland"
  • 1994: Featured opposite Diane Keaton in the TNT biopic "Amelia Earhart: The Final Flight"
  • 1992: Played one of the undead in the film "Buffy the Vampire Slayer"
  • 1991: American film debut, "Nighthawks"
  • 1987: Co-starred in the TV-movie "Escape From Sobibor"
  • 1985: Starred opposite Michelle Pfeiffer in "Ladyhawke"
  • 1982: Had breakthrough screen role as a replicant in "Blade Runner"
  • 1982: American TV debut, starring as Hitler's personal architect Albert Speer in "Inside the Third Reich", an ABC docudrama miniseries
  • 1979: Starred in his international breakthrough role, Verhoeven's "Soldier of Orange"
  • 1975: First English-language film, "The Wilby Conspiracy", a British feature set in South Africa starring Sidney Poitier and Michael Caine
  • 1973: Film debut, "Turkish Delight"; first film with Dutch director Paul Verhoeven
  • 1967: Stage debut
  • 1967: Toured Dutch farmlands with a theater group for six years
  • 1960: Joined the Dutch Army at age 16; applied to the officer's commission to become mountain climber, was eventually turned down
  • 1959: Worked as merchant seaman on tea schooner at age 15 (lied about his age; date approximate)
  • Studied drama at the University of Amsterdam
